在互联网时代,网页跳转是用户与网站互动的重要方式。无论是浏览新闻、购物还是社交,网页跳转都极大地丰富了我们的在线体验。本文将深入探讨网页跳转的技巧,帮助您轻松实现高效导航,掌握页面切换的艺术。

一、网页跳转的基本原理

网页跳转通常通过以下几种方式实现:

  1. 超链接(Hyperlink):这是最常见的跳转方式,通过在文本或图片上设置链接,用户点击后可以跳转到另一个页面。
  2. 表单提交(Form Submission):用户填写表单并提交后,表单数据会被发送到服务器,服务器处理后再跳转到新的页面。
  3. JavaScript 代码:通过编写 JavaScript 代码,可以实现页面内跳转、页面间跳转以及定时跳转等功能。

二、超链接的设置与优化

1. 超链接的基本设置

超链接的设置非常简单,以下是一个简单的例子:

<a href="https://www.example.com">访问 Example 网站</a>

在这个例子中,href 属性指定了跳转的目标网址。

2. 超链接的优化技巧

  • 使用描述性的链接文本:避免使用“点击这里”等模糊的文本,而是使用具体的描述,如“查看产品详情”。
  • 添加 title 属性:为链接添加 title 属性,当鼠标悬停在链接上时,会显示更多关于链接的信息。
  • 使用锚点实现页面内跳转:在页面内部设置锚点,用户可以通过点击锚点实现页面内的快速跳转。

三、表单提交的设置与优化

1. 表单提交的基本设置

以下是一个简单的表单提交示例:

<form action="https://www.example.com/submit" method="post">
  <input type="text" name="username" placeholder="请输入用户名">
  <input type="submit" value="提交">
</form>

在这个例子中,action 属性指定了表单提交后要跳转的网址,method 属性指定了提交方式(GET 或 POST)。

2. 表单提交的优化技巧

  • 验证表单数据:在提交前对用户输入的数据进行验证,确保数据的正确性和完整性。
  • 异步提交表单:使用 JavaScript 实现异步表单提交,提高用户体验。

四、JavaScript 代码实现页面跳转

1. 页面内跳转

以下是一个页面内跳转的示例:

function jumpToElement(elementId) {
  var element = document.getElementById(elementId);
  if (element) {
    element.scrollIntoView();
  }
}

2. 页面间跳转

以下是一个页面间跳转的示例:

function redirectTo(url) {
  window.location.href = url;
}

3. 定时跳转

以下是一个定时跳转的示例:

setTimeout(function() {
  redirectTo("https://www.example.com");
}, 5000); // 5秒后跳转到 Example 网站

五、总结

网页跳转是网站设计和开发中不可或缺的一部分。通过掌握网页跳转的技巧,您可以实现高效导航,提升用户体验。本文介绍了超链接、表单提交和 JavaScript 代码实现页面跳转的方法,希望对您有所帮助。